A Comprehensive Guide to Small Prams for Newborns
When preparing for a new arrival, novice moms and dads often find themselves overwhelmed by the sheer volume of baby products available on the marketplace. Amongst these, choosing the right pram or stroller is crucial. For moms and dads who reside in city settings or have actually limited storage area, small prams can be a useful service. This short article provides an in-depth look at small prams for newborns, highlighting their features, benefits, and considerations to help parents make informed decisions.
What is a Small Pram?
A small pram, typically described as a compact stroller, pushchair twin, go to this site, is designed to be light-weight and easy to steer in tight spaces. These prams typically have a smaller sized footprint compared to conventional strollers, making them ideal for city dwellers and moms and dads who regularly navigate crowded locations or mass transit.
Secret Features of Small Prams
When assessing small prams for newborns, parents ought to consider the following functions:
Feature | Description |
---|---|
Weight | Many small prams weigh less than 15 pounds, making them easy to carry and transfer. |
Foldability | Lots of small prams can be folded with one hand, facilitating simple storage and transportation. |
Size | Compact measurements guarantee they suit smaller spaces and appropriate for public transportation. |
Seat recline | Prams with numerous recline positions enable newborns to lie flat, which is crucial for their security and convenience. |
Safety harness | Secure five-point harness systems keep the baby safely in location during trips. |
Storage choices | Search for prams with baskets or pouches to carry fundamentals and baby paraphernalia. |
Advantages of Using Small Prams for Newborns
Small prams included several benefits specifically for newborns and their parents, including:
Enhanced Maneuverability: Urban environments often present narrow walkways and crowded areas. A small pram is simpler to navigate and kip down tight areas.
Convenience: Lightweight styles and fast folding capabilities suggest parents can easily fill prams into vehicles or bring them onto public transportation without breaking a sweat.
Comfort: Many compact prams boast quality cushioning and adjustable recline choices, making sure that newborns remain comfy during getaways.
Cost: Smaller prams are often more affordable than larger models, making them available for parents seeking practical but affordable services.
Adaptability: Many small prams are designed to accommodate newborns up to young children, offering long-lasting use as the kid grows.
Considerations When Choosing a Small Pram
While small prams offer numerous advantages, parents need to take particular factors to consider into account before purchase:
- Age Appropriateness: Ensure the pram is developed for newborns, with proper recline and security features.
- Surface Type: Evaluate where you will mostly utilize the pram. Some small prams are much better matched for smooth surface areas, whereas others can manage rougher surface.
- Resilience: While light-weight is advantageous, guarantee the pram is likewise tough and well-constructed. Search for models made from long lasting materials to weather routine use.
- Ease of Use: Consider how easy it is to fold, unfold, and change the pram. Evaluations and demonstrations can offer useful insights.
- Storage Space: Compact style does not need to compromise on storage. Search for prams with effective storage options for diaper bags and personal products.

Frequently asked question Section
Q1: Can I utilize a small pram uk for my newborn?A: Yes, numerous small prams are created for newborns and feature ideal recline options for safety. Q2: What need to I search for in a small pram?A: Focus on weight, foldability, security functions, recline alternatives, and total resilience. Q3: Are small prams safe for everyday use?A: Absolutely, as long as they meet safety standardsand are designed for newborns. Q4: Can small prams handle rough terrain?A: Some small prams are created for numerous terrains, but it is vital to check product requirements to ensure suitability. Q5: How long can I utilize a small pram?A: Many small prams double can be utilized from newborn phase up to toddlerhood, depending on weight limits and design requirements.
